PINE VALLEY, N.Y. - The University of Scranton men's tennis team opened the spring portion of their 2018-19 schedule on Saturday at Elmira in style, as the Royals shutout the host Soaring Eagles, 9-0, in a match held at the MAC Tennis Dome.
With the win, Scranton moved to 3-0 in matches for the season, while Elmira fell to 0-3 with the loss.
The domination on the day for Scranton started in doubles, where the Royals swept the one through three spots in the line-up to take a 3-0 lead into singles.
At number one, sophomore Tarquin McGurrin (Clarks Summit, Pa./Scranton Prep) and senior Alexander Ochalski (Hopewell, N.J./Hopewell Valley Central) rolled to an 8-0 win, while at number two, the senior tandem of Brian Harkins (New Fairfield, Conn./New Fairfield) and Charles Swope (Malvern, Pa./Great Valley) also shutout their opponents in another 8-0 win.
Finally, at number three doubles, the freshman duo of Christopher Kocon (Mountain Top, Pa./Holy Redeemer) and Adrian Maggiani (Marshfield, Mass./Marshfield) posted an 8-3 victory to give Scranton the 3-0 lead into singles.
It was more of the same in singles, where the Royals took six matches, all in straight sets, to collect the 9-0 win.
Overall, McGurrin (6-2, 6-2 at number one), Ochalski (6-0, 6-0 at number two), Swope (6-1, 6-0 at number three) and Harkins (6-0, 6-0 at number four) became two-time winners on the day with their victories in the top four spots of the singles line-up.
At number five singles, graduate student Christian Aksu (Exton, Pa./Central Bucks West) posted a 6-0, 6-0 win, as did freshman Daniel Scala (Lancaster, Pa./Conestoga Valley) at number six to complete the sweep for Scranton.
The University of Scranton men's tennis team returns to action on Saturday, March 2nd, as they travel to Pratt for another non-conference match. Action starts at 12 p.m.
